Output 6b952640c06a1a24d7b1594a66f327ee37d82f9772f3a82ea4a33fb54bdc521b:1

value
1423198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a5851f39792a54a5db4b136a9f2da4dc486bc24 OP_EQUAL
address
2N8mvfV5LHALHaQZiF2CEfghiTKWrMVaemh
transaction
6b952640c06a1a24d7b1594a66f327ee37d82f9772f3a82ea4a33fb54bdc521b